Solution for 7[3q+14]-31=76-6[2q+7] equation:


Simplifying
7[3q + 14] + -31 = 76 + -6[2q + 7]

Reorder the terms:
7[14 + 3q] + -31 = 76 + -6[2q + 7]
[14 * 7 + 3q * 7] + -31 = 76 + -6[2q + 7]
[98 + 21q] + -31 = 76 + -6[2q + 7]

Reorder the terms:
98 + -31 + 21q = 76 + -6[2q + 7]

Combine like terms: 98 + -31 = 67
67 + 21q = 76 + -6[2q + 7]

Reorder the terms:
67 + 21q = 76 + -6[7 + 2q]
67 + 21q = 76 + [7 * -6 + 2q * -6]
67 + 21q = 76 + [-42 + -12q]

Combine like terms: 76 + -42 = 34
67 + 21q = 34 + -12q

Solving
67 + 21q = 34 + -12q

Solving for variable 'q'.

Move all terms containing q to the left, all other terms to the right.

Add '12q' to each side of the equation.
67 + 21q + 12q = 34 + -12q + 12q

Combine like terms: 21q + 12q = 33q
67 + 33q = 34 + -12q + 12q

Combine like terms: -12q + 12q = 0
67 + 33q = 34 + 0
67 + 33q = 34

Add '-67' to each side of the equation.
67 + -67 + 33q = 34 + -67

Combine like terms: 67 + -67 = 0
0 + 33q = 34 + -67
33q = 34 + -67

Combine like terms: 34 + -67 = -33
33q = -33

Divide each side by '33'.
q = -1

Simplifying
q = -1
